I wonder, because mine is a Samsung (about two or three years old), and while it has a “game mode” to reduce lag by about 30%, it’s still very noticeable in timing-sensitive games. I’ve disabled all the post-processing effects, but even without them, the TV still has to scale the image up to fit the vertical panes and also has to de-interlace anything not running in progressive scan mode. For PS2 Garou, this looks really ugly because while in T.O.P. mode, the characters have permanent scanlines when they should be blinking rapidly - that’s the case with any flashing sprites, like the shadows simulating transparency.
I haven’t been able to circumvent those two things, so I stick with emulation. It’s a shame HDTVs haven’t really overcome this, they still have only have one or two native resolutions.
